  • Aggregate Crushing Value (ACV)Testing Procedure

      Test Name: Methods for determination of Aggregate Crushing Value (ACV) Code: BS 812 Part 110, IS 2386 Definition of ACV: Aggregate Crushing Value (ACV) gives an relative measure how the aggregate act under an gradually acting compressive load Sieve Size: ACV is applicable for aggregates passing 140 mm sieve and retained on 1000 mm sieve For other size fractions methods are   The aggregate crushing value (ACV) of an aggregate is the mass of material, expressed as a percentage of the test sample which is crushed finer than a 2,36 mm sieve when a sample of aggregate passing the 13,2 mm and retained on the 9,50 mm sieve is subjected to crushing under a gradually applied compressive load of 400 kN 2 APPARATUSMETHOD B1 THE DETERMINATION OF THE AGGREGATE The method is applicable to aggregates passing a 140 mm test sieve and retained on a 100 mm test sieve For other size fractions, a recommended method is described in an appendix to this standard The method is not suitable for testing aggregates with an aggregate crushing value higher than 30, and in such cases the method for ten per cent BS 812110:1990 Testing aggregates Methods for
